How Formula 1 Card Values Are Determined

Across Ithaca, card value is affected by physical condition and third-party grading, which provide trust in authenticity and quality. Rarity from limited releases and rookie editions profoundly impacts worth. Collector demand is influenced by driver prominence and recent success, while provenance and connection to historical races add premium value.

Tips Before Selling Formula 1 Cards in Ithaca

  • Check recent sale prices specific to the Ithaca region and online marketplaces.
  • Understand grading procedures from credentialed services to improve sale confidence.
  • Ensure cards are free from damage and maintain original packaging if possible.
  • Verify authenticity for signatures and rare inserts with documentation.
  • Engage with local collectors or stores to assess market interest.
  • Study trends related to rookie cards and limited edition sets.
